Blackline Delivers Q4 That Was Solid By Any Measure

Bhavan Suri of William Blair reiterated his Outperform rating on Blackline Inc BL after the company reported above consensus fourth quarter results.

Following is a gist of Blackline’s results:

  • BlackLine Reports Q4 Adj. EPS $(0.08) vs $(0.12) Est., Sales $35.3M vs $34.13M Est.
  • BlackLine Sees Q1 Adj. EPS $(0.10)-$(0.08) vs $(0.13) Est., Sales $36.8M-$37.8M vs $35.5M Est.
  • BlackLine Sees FY17 Adj. EPS $(0.35)-$(0.31) vs $(0.42) Est., Sales $166.5M-$169.5M vs $160.8M Est.

Suri says the results shows healthy underlying business momentum as Blackline delivered upside of $1.3 million on subscription revenue, $1.8 million on total revenue, and $1.8 million on net income. In addition, calculated billings rose 62 percent to $48.9 million.

The financial software company also guided first quarter and fiscal 2017 above Street.

“All in, we believe BlackLine posted a strong quarter,” Suri wrote in a note.

Shares of Blackline closed Thursday’s trading at $29.30.
